Bayer Built a Knowledge Graph That Predicts Heart Failure Drug Targets

Bayer’s R&D team fused cardiac imaging with 18 biological databases in a Neo4j knowledge graph, identifying druggable gene targets across three major cardiovascular diseases and surfacing existing medications as repurposing candidates.
